The School of Nursing and Midwifery at the University of Hull are looking forward to working with four new External Examiners for modules within our BSc (Hons) Nursing pre-registration and apprenticeship nursing programme.

The duties of the position are as follows:

  • Consideration and moderation of students’ assessments of theory and practice learning.
  • Submission of an External Examiner’s Annual Report
  • Membership and attendance at Boards of Examiners
  • Collaboration with programme directors, module leaders and administrative colleagues to inform the continued monitoring, review and enhancement of these programmes.

External examiners appointments are typically for a period of four years and the appointment is for the start of the 2023 academic year. We welcome applicants who are new to externally examining as well as applicants with relevant experience. Experience and knowledge of pre-registration nursing education is essential and applicants must also be adult field nurses registered with the Nursing and Midwifery Council. Appointment is subject to meeting the university’s criteria for the appointment of External Examiners. A full induction to the university can be provided.
